Use it for an easy Frankfurt meal, not a trophy booking
The clearest planning advantage is the schedule. Lhamo Bistro serves lunch from 11 AM to 2:45 PM on Monday and Wednesday to Saturday, and dinner from 5–10 PM on Monday and Wednesday to Sunday. It is closed on Tuesday, and Sunday is evening service only. Those hours make the venue easiest to read through the lens of availability: it can work for a midday meal on the listed lunch days, or for a straightforward evening plan across most of the week, with Tuesday removed from consideration entirely.

Ordering Tips
The kitchen keeps the menu rooted in simple, well-made preparations; among the signatures are momo and thukpa, which are good starting points if you want a sense of the place. Expect dishes that emphasize technique and produce rather than heavy refinement. Given the bistro’s modest, neighbourhood character, ordering a mix of staples and small plates lets you sample the kitchen’s strengths—start with the momo and follow with the thukpa to get a clear sense of the house style.
